CP_Orange: Natural

Description
A 5-Control Point map, CP_Orange: Natural is an overhauled version of 'cp_orange_x3', made to give the map's iconic layout more color and life featuring an alpine-themed setting, and to also fix a bunch of bugs.

Other significant changes include the redesign of spawns to favor players' flow (especially Engineers), the cover added to the second Control Point zones, and the addition of medkits and ammo packs under the Tower's bridges.


Proudly brought to fans with much-appreciated help from:
  • WhiteWolf_X - ported 'dod_orange' (made by BSL for Day of Defeat) to TF2, thus creating the first cp_orange map. Also gave me permission to create my own variation.
  • GGODD2 - created 'cp_orange_x3' as an improvement over WhiteWolf_X's 'cp_orange_x' map and gave me permission to use it to create my own variation.
  • TF2Maps.net & Mapeadores.com - helped solve some questions about displacements and texture rotation.
